The Korean proverb “긁어 부스럼 만들다” is not that hard to understand as a lot of English proverbs that have the same meaning. The Korean proverb talks about scratching boils. In the English proverbs they talk about hornet’s nests or sleeping dogs. Perhaps with that you already know the meaning now. Indeed, you can “긁어 부스럼 만들다” to warn people against doing something as that might bring more trouble than they are willing to take on. #LearnKorean #Korean #한국한국어 Korean proverb “긁어 부스럼 만들다” is not that har

kimbapnoona: Pronun: Jo-un ha-roo dweh-se-yo This can me made into ‘have a nice/good day today’ by adding ‘oneul/오늘’ at the beginning :) Also another way to say this is ‘joheun haru bonaeseyo/좋은 하루 보내세요’. Both are polite forms.
